Why are flowers from a florist expensive?

Florists source high-quality, fresh blooms from trusted suppliers, often local growers. They invest in skilled craftsmanship to create unique, bespoke arrangements, and their prices reflect the overhead costs of running a business, including shop rent, staff wages, and the expertise involved. While supermarkets and roadside stalls may offer lower prices, they typically provide standard bunches without the same care, attention to detail, or personalised service that florists offer.
